Impact of pulmonary rehabilitation, prescribed by nurses, in the capacity for self-care's person with COPD. RPER [online]. 2020, vol.3, suppl.2, pp.80-85.  Epub Jan 05, 2022. ISSN 2184-965X.  https://doi.org/10.33194/rper.2020.v3.n2.12.5823.

Introduction:

Pulmonary Rehabilitation (PR) is a central component in the non-pharmacological treatment of COPD. One of the primary elements of PR is exercise training. However, little is known about the effectiveness of conducting these programs by nurses.

Objectives:

Identify the impact of an PR program, prescribed by nurses, on the capacity for self-care of the person with COPD.

Methods::

Systematic literature review until February 4, 2019, using MEDLINE, EMBASE, Web of Science Core Collection, Scopus, and CINAHL.

Results:

The systematic literature review included 1 article which showed that people undergoing PR programmes, supervised by nurses, revealed a decrease in fatigue levels, an improvement in their life quality and in the daily routine tasks/activities execution.

Conclusion:

This review allowed to identify that nurse-led interventions has positive impact over fatigue, health related quality of life and in daily living activity performance of COPD patients.
